For Assassin’s Creed Valhalla version 1.7.0, the most reliable way to use Cheat Engine is through community-maintained Cheat Tables (.CT files) that have been updated to support the game's final major patches. These tables allow you to bypass server-side restrictions for most inventory items and modify core gameplay values. Core Functionalities for 1.7.0
A standard working table for this version typically includes the following features:
Inventory Editor: Allows you to add specific items, including Helix Store items, Event rewards, and Uplay exclusives.
Infinite Resources: Provides unlimited Silver, crafting materials (Leather, Iron Ore), and consumables like Rations.
Experience & Power Multipliers: Can instantly set your power level or multiply XP gain to reach level 400+ quickly.
God Mode & Stealth: Options for infinite health, stamina, adrenaline, and a "No Detection" mode to ignore enemies.
Teleportation: Scripts to save your current location or teleport directly to a custom map waypoint. How to Use the 1.7.0 Cheat Table
Preparation: Download and install the latest version of Cheat Engine. Ensure you have a backup of your game save before proceeding. Loading the Table: Open Cheat Engine.
Load the .CT file (e.g., from FearLess Revolution or Reddit community threads) by double-clicking it or using File > Load. Attaching to the Game: Launch Assassin’s Creed Valhalla.
In Cheat Engine, click the PC icon and select the ACValhalla.exe process.
When prompted to "Keep the current address list," click Yes. Activation:
For many scripts (like the Inventory Editor), you must use the VEH Debugger. Go to Edit > Settings > Debugger Options and select "Use VEH Debugger".
Check the boxes next to the desired cheats in the list at the bottom to activate them. Important Limitations & Risks
Server-Side Items: You cannot use Cheat Engine to modify "Opal" or other currency stored on Ubisoft's servers.
Crash Risks: Modifying values like XP or inventory hashes too aggressively can lead to game crashes or broken save files. Always use specific "Auto Assemble" scripts provided for your exact game version.
Ban Potential: While primarily a single-player game, Ubisoft has a history of enforcing bans for "stealing" Helix Store items through memory manipulation in their newer titles.
